But, Antony’s own MoD itself issues a detailed statement chronicling what happened in detail, which is unusual for the secretive MoD.

In 2003, when the proposal came up for Vajpayee for approval his secretary noticed that the specifications were set so high, to ensure that only one vendor EuroCopter would qualify. That was deemed unacceptable as these were not combat helicopters but normal VVIP transport ones. Hence the suggestion was made to lower the flying height requirements so that more bidders became eligible and prices will become lower… Yes, this is the “specification altering” that the media is talking about as having done by NDA… Please educate yourselves…

After UPA came to power shortly thereafter, the suggestion was made an official decision a year later opening the gates for 4 companies to submit tenders and further changes were made in 2010 to make AugustaWestland the “only company eligible”… Again under AK Antony… After that due diligence in terms of trials were completed and orders placed and some delivered as well…
